Burn the Boats
How to commit fully and make retreat impossible
Hey brother,
Every man says he wants to change.
But most leave a back door open
just in case it gets hard.
They say they’re done drinking…
but keep the contacts saved.
They say they want to build a business…
but never delete the job apps.
They say they’re all in…
but live like they’re half out.
Here’s the truth:
If you want to become the man you say you are,
you have to burn the boats.
The Belief Shift: No Plan B. No exit. No safety net.
The reason most men stay stuck is simple.
They always give themselves a way out.
Change requires full commitment.
Not when it’s easy.
Not when it’s convenient.
But when there’s no turning back.
If you want the life you’ve never had,
you have to eliminate every path back to the old one.
The Solution: 3 Ways to Burn the Boats
→ Step 1: Identify Your Escape Hatches
Where are you still playing it safe?
• Do you keep “just one” vice around?
• Do you keep toxic people in your life “just in case”?
• Do you keep saying “I’ll start next week”?
Get honest.
List the doors you keep cracked open.
→ Step 2: Eliminate the Option
Don’t negotiate with the old you.
Cut it off.
Delete the numbers.
Remove the apps.
Throw it out.
Quit the thing that’s killing your confidence.
Make it impossible to retreat.
→ Step 3: Burn It Publicly
Tell someone. Post about it.
Commit in a way that adds weight.
Let the world know who you are becoming
and don’t give your past self a place to hide.
This is how you change for real.
You go all in.
You burn the boats.
And you never look back.
